## Understanding the fundamentals
|
||||
There are 3 important parts in Fredy, that you need to understand to leverage the full power of _Fredy_.
|
||||
|
||||
#### Provider
|
||||
_Fredy_ supports multiple services. Immonet, Immowelt and Ebay are just a few examples. Those services are called providers within _Fredy_. When creating a new job, you can choose one or more providers.
|
||||
A provider contains the URL that points to the search results for the respective service. If you go to immonet.de and search for something, the displayed URL in the browser is what the provider needs to do its magic.
|
||||
**It is important that you order the search results by date, so that _Fredy_ always picks the latest results first!**
|
||||
|
||||
#### Adapter
|
||||
_Fredy_ supports multiple adapters, such as Slack, SendGrid, Telegram etc. A search job can have as many adapters as supported by _Fredy_. Each adapter needs different configuration values, which you have to provide when using them. A adapter dictactes how the frontend renders by telling the frontend what information it needs in order to send listings to the user.
|
||||
|
||||
#### Jobs
|
||||
A Job wraps adapters and providers. _Fredy_ runs the configured jobs in a specific interval (can be configured in `/conf/config.json`).
|
||||
|
||||
## Creating your first job
|
||||
To create your first job, click on the button "Create New Job" on the job table. The job creation dialog should be self-explanatory, however there is one important thing.
|
||||
When configuring providers, before copying the URL from your browser, make sure that you have sorted the results by date to make sure _Fredy_ always picks the latest results first.
|
||||
|
||||
## User management
|
||||
As an administrator, you can create, edit and remove users from _Fredy_. Be careful, each job is connected to the user that has created the job. If you remove the user, their jobs will also be removed.

### Telegram Adapter
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
For Telegram, you need to create a Bot. This is pretty easy. Open [this](https://telegram.me/BotFather) url on your smartphone and follow the instructions.
|
||||
|
||||
A telegram bot is not allowed to send messages directly to a user, you as a user need to first contact the bot to get a chatId.
|
||||
After the user has send a message to your bot the first time, you can gather the chatId like this:
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
curl -X GET https://api.telegram.org/bot{YOUR_TELEGRAM_TOKEN}/getUpdates
|
||||
```
